The national commission of colleges of education organizes a 2 days strategic workshop on the challenges of dwindling NCE student enrollment in Nigeria colleges of education.
The workshop is primarily to focus on salient issues affecting the students enrollment into Nigeria colleges of education and as well as finding a lasting solution in resolving the problem.
The provosts and registrars of these institutions gathered in Abuja brainstorming to identify the major causes of the problems and proffer solution to that effect.
Dr. Olu Andrew Kayode while speaking with the journalists after the meeting describes the NCEE Strategic Workshop On Dwindling Enrolment in the Colleges of Education as Timely and Resourceful.
According to him , he express his displeasure over the threat of increasing the students of colleges of education in higher institutions.
He explained further that students are facing serious challenges in getting admission into universities. Reiterated that urgent steps has to be taken to resolve the issue. Also government should do more about the insecurity , adding that, there's no problem without a solution.
The registrar also talk about introduction of new method into the curriculum to make student self reliance and as well as looking at the issue of reducing the subjects been offered by bringing them together for learning.
He equaly lamented the poor welfare condition and poor remuration of the teachers urging the government to motivate them in order to discharge their work diligently.
